
A Classic Italian Dish with a Fresh Twist
Shrimp scampi linguine is a classic Italian dish that has been enjoyed for decades. It’s a simple and delicious meal that can be made in under 30 minutes. The dish typically consists of linguine pasta, shrimp, and a buttery garlic sauce. In this recipe, we’re adding a fresh twist by including asparagus, which adds a great crunch and a burst of color to the dish.
